i'm the doctor that invented the procedure. 
there is now a non surgical nose job (non surgical rhinoplasty) procedure that is permanent. i am starting to use artefill instead of radiesse to achieve the same great results. the only difference is that artefill is a permanent filler, whereas radiesse lasts for 1 year. artefill was just fda approved in january. i am recommending that people get the temporary non surgical nose job procedure first, make sure they like the results and only after the radiesse disappears to get the artefill procedure. after all, once you put in artefill, you can't take it out.
